  • Patent number: 5466463
    Abstract: A vaginal suppository or other type of vaginal pessary such as cream, foam or ointment, which contains as its active ingredients at least one pharmaceutically acceptable, topically safe antimicrobial agent, such as an agent selected from the group of benzalkonium chloride, cetylpyridinium chloride, chlorhexidine gluconate and povidone iodine, imidiazolidinyl urea and diazolidinyl urea and a viable colony of micro-encapsulated lactobacilli bacteria. The viable lactobacilli are included in the suppository in micro encapsulated form, which protects the bacteria during storage of the suppository from the action of the bacteriocidal agent. When exposed to the vaginal milieu the micro encapsulation breaks down sufficiently to release the lactobacili bacteria. The lactobacilli bacteria serve to maintain or re-establish a healthy lactobacilli based flora on the vaginal wall, and excrete hydrogen peroxide and other bactericidins which suppress abnormal flora conditions that promote infections.

  • Patent number: 5264619
    Abstract: Compounds having the formula (i), (ii) and (iii), ##STR1## where R is H, alkyl of 1 to 6 carbons, or CO--R.sub.2 where R.sub.2 is alkyl of 1 to 6 carbons; R.sub.1 is H, CH.sub.3, or (CH.sub.2).sub.m --CH.sub.3 ; n is an integer having the values of 2 to 10, m is an integer having the values of 1 to 6, have anti-androgen activity on secondary androgen receptor sites. The compounds are useful for treating mammals, including humans afflicted with acne, male pattern baldness, adhesions and keloids. The compounds are also effective for treating other diseases or conditions which are related to androgen receptors, such as undesirable formation of breast capsules in females after breast augmentation surgery, osteoarthritis and symptoms of Alzheimer's disease. The compounds also have inhibitory effect on the metabolism of certain microorganisms and fungi of the kind, the metabolism of which is normally known to be controllable by anti-androgen compounds.

  • Patent number: 4255517
    Abstract: A new and improved assay for the determination of the enzyme lysozyme in biological samples which utilizes a plate assay based upon the bacterium Micrococcus lysodiekticus is described. The assay utilizes a novel composition for the assay medium which results in a reduction in assay incubation time to the point that the assay is complete after one-half hour. This reduction in time is achieved in part by the utilization of organic buffers in the assay medium and in part by the reduction of the ionic strength of the assay medium. by the use of this assay a novel technique for determining the integrity of the amniochorial membrane and maturity of fetal lungs are described.
